For the wild salmon, for the orcas, for the bears and other wildlife that depend on wild salmon populations, for indigenous rights, for our beautiful coast, for your children and all future generations! This Thursday, we need your voice.

The BC NDP Cabinet is meeting with First Nation leaders September 6&7 at the Vancouver Convention Center WEST. Please join us for a rally on Thursday from 11am - 1pm, to tell the BC government not to renew the salmon farm licenses of occupation in the Broughton Archipelago.

The Wild Salmon Defenders Alliance will rally in solidarity with Musgamagw Dzawada'enuxw, Namgis and Mamalilikulla who are occupying two fish farms to assert their Indigenous rights and and responsibilities to care for their unceded territory and fishing resources. We are calling on the BC Cabinet to exercise provincial jurisdiction to revoke licences of occupation given to fish farms in their territories, thus putting an end to 30 years of fish farm violations of their Indigenous rights, and result in a very meaningful act of reconciliation.

It's time for ALL BC citizens to take a stance. We have seen the footage and the evidence of disease within these fish farms. We have seen the endangered herring and wild salmon trapped in the pens. We have seen the deformations, the open wounds, the sea lice, the emaciated fish, the clouds of waste. We have seen the entanglements of whales and other sea life. Thanks to Alexandra Morton, First Nation leaders, the crew of the R/V Martin Sheen, and so many others, we know what is going on out there.  This new music video is the signature piece of the album by the same name. It is a sequel to Dana's hit music video entitled "Salmon Come Home."

The Great Salish Sea is sung from the perspective of "Granny," the 104-year old matriarch of our bioregion's resident orcas. It highlights adverse changes to the underwater acoustic environment through the last century, in the context of visually stunning imagery and soulful lyrics.Enjoy! :)

An Eco Music Video: Kinder Morgan is proposing adding a second pipeline across BC to Burnaby, tripling the flow of Tarsands Oil & forcing 400 Tankers per year past Vancouver's harbour & beaches.

The Tsleil Waututh Nation Sacred Trust invites our neighbours to protect the Salish Sea! More Info: http://twnsacredtrust.ca/
